旅馆床位管理系统文档.docx

上传人:b****6 文档编号:5772970 上传时间:2023-01-01 格式:DOCX 页数:18 大小:427.83KB
下载 相关 举报
旅馆床位管理系统文档.docx_第1页
第1页 / 共18页
旅馆床位管理系统文档.docx_第2页
第2页 / 共18页
旅馆床位管理系统文档.docx_第3页
第3页 / 共18页
旅馆床位管理系统文档.docx_第4页
第4页 / 共18页
旅馆床位管理系统文档.docx_第5页
第5页 / 共18页
点击查看更多>>
下载资源
资源描述

旅馆床位管理系统文档.docx

《旅馆床位管理系统文档.docx》由会员分享,可在线阅读,更多相关《旅馆床位管理系统文档.docx(18页珍藏版)》请在冰豆网上搜索。

旅馆床位管理系统文档.docx

旅馆床位管理系统文档

一、需求分析

随着电子电子计算机技术的进步,为各行各业的自动化管理打开了方便之门。

在新的条件下,有必要实现旅馆的自动化管理,提高旅馆工作人员的效率。

本系统从对旅馆的核心业务——床位的管理出发,着眼于为旅馆管理创造自动化的办公环境而开发。

一、功能需求:

该系统主要实现旅馆管理的下述功能:

1、实现床位的分配和回收。

旅客住店时,把旅客信息及其住房要求输入计算机系统中,快速获取符合旅客需求的房间等级、空房和空床信息,为旅客提供满意的服务。

旅客退房时,把所退房间的等级、空房和空床信息录入计算机系统中,自动完成退房工作。

2、查询。

对整个旅馆床位信息的查询:

根据对旅馆实际情况的调查,主要实现如下查询:

全店可分配男床位总数及女床位总数的查询、各个等级可分配男床总数和女床总数的查询、各个等级的空房信息和房间利用情况的查询。

还有对旅客信息的查询,包括现在正入住或者已经入住的旅客信息的查询。

另外,查询中,系统还实现了旅客信息的实时修改功能。

3、系统重置。

可对系统数据进行清空,实现该系统的再次利用。

二、系统运行环境要求:

硬件需求:

并不要求很高的系统配置,能运行windows系统和office办公软件的计算机系统即可。

建议配置:

计算机主频500MHZ以上,内存64M以上,硬盘10G以上,显卡缓存16M以上。

软件需求:

操作系统最好是MicrosoftWindows2000Server/professional或者以上版本,另外需装MicrosoftOffice2000access数据库。

二、数据库结构

该系统设计一个数据库,名为rmis.mdb。

下面包含五个数据表,分别ginfo表、groom表、room表、rclass表、info_store表。

(上面‘g’表示‘guest’)

一、ginfo表

该表主要用来记录入住旅客的个人信息。

字段名

字段类型

大小

是否允许空值

说明

Gno

Text

4

旅客入住后,自动为其分配一旅客号,作为住关键字以便检索。

Name

Text

8

旅客姓名

Age

Integer

年龄

Type

Text

1

1——男

2——女

Dat

Text

10

旅客到达日期

二、groom表

该表用来记录入住旅客的住房信息

字段名

字段类型

大小

是否允许空值

说明

Gno

Text

4

入住旅客号

Rno

Text

3

房间号

Num

Integer

1

旅客入住床位号

三、room表

该表用来记录房间号对应的房间等级及类别信息。

字段名

字段类型

大小

是否允许空值

说明

Rno

Text

3

房间号

 

Class

 

Text

 

1

 

房间等级有如下几种:

1——普通单间

2——普通双人间

3——普通三人间

4——普通四人间

5——标准间

6——豪华间

7——总统套房

Bsurplus

Integer

房间剩余床位数

Type

Text

1

0——空房间

1——男房

2——女房

四、rclass表

该表用来记录房间等级和该等级房间对应的床位数信息。

字段名

字段类型

大小

是否允许空值

说明

Class

Text

1

房间等级

 

ClassName

 

Text

 

10

 

房间等级的名称:

1——普通单间

2——普通双人间

3——普通三人间

4——普通四人间

5——标准间

6——豪华间

7——总统套房

Cnum

Integer

 

该等级房间所含床位数。

五、info_store表

该表用来记录所有旅客(已经入住或者曾经入住的旅客)信息,并长期保存。

以便利用入住日期和姓名查询。

字段名

字段类型

大小

是否允许空值

字段说明

Gno

Text

4

Name

Text

8

Age

Integer

Type

Text

1

Chk_in_dat

Text

10

入住日期

Rno

Text

3

Num

Text

1

Chk_out_dat

Text

10

旅客退店前,该字段不录入;退店时,必须录入。

 

三、算法框图

该系统主要有三个功能模块,即床位分配模块,床位回收模块,查询模块。

由于系统并不是很复杂,这里用算法框图代替数据流程图。

一、床位分配算法框图

二、床位回收算法框图

Y

N

Y

Y

N

 

 

 

三、查询模块分为两个功能。

可以按等级进行旅客入住信息的查询和空房间及空床位的查询;还可以按日期和旅客姓名对曾经入住旅客的信息进行查询。

在按房间等级进行的查询中,把“全店”也作为一种房间等级,作为进行查询的条件。

1、信息查询的算法框图

按房间等级进行旅客入住信息查询的算法框图

 

根据房间等级旅客入住信息查询的结果,按旅客要求修改入住信息的算法框图

 

N

 

注:

“相关条件”指如下条件:

1、该房间不存在

2、该房间客满

3、该房间为异性客房

4、该床位不存在

5、该床位已由其他旅客使用

 

按房间等级进行剩余床位信息查询的算法框图

2、按日期和旅客姓名对曾经入住旅客信息进行查询的算法框图

上面是系统三个模块的算法框图。

这三个模块通过数据库rmis.mdb有机的联系在一起,通过对数据库的各种操作,完成旅店管理信息系统包括床位分配、回收和查询等应有的全部功能。

四、使用说明书

程序启动后,进入下面的画面。

工作人员可根据菜单选项进行床位分配、回收以及查询工作。

 

一、床位分配

下面先看床位管理菜单下的床位分配和回收功能模块。

单击床位分配,如下所示:

该界面为旅客分配房间,并接受个人信息。

数据输入后,如果旅客要求等级客满,可按旅客要求进行更换房间等级。

旅客房间分配成功后,给出以下入住信息:

二、床位回收

如果是单击床位回收,则界面如下所示:

工作人员输入要退房的旅客编号,并确认旅客退房,界面如下:

单击确认,旅客退房成功。

单击取消,旅客暂不退房。

如果旅客忘记自己的编号,可单击“忘记编号?

”按钮。

 

输入旅客姓名,点击查询得到如下结果:

确认旅客的个人信息,选定后,单击“确认退房”,旅客退房成功。

三、查询模块

下面我们看一下查询模块:

 

1、按等级查询现在旅客入住信息

单击按等级查询,得如下窗体:

在上面的窗体中,显示的是等级选择为“全店”时的入住信息,工作人员可自选等级进行入住信息的查询。

当工作人员选择一个等级时,然后进行该等级入住信息的查询,窗体如下所示:

上图是对房间等级为“普通三人间”的房间的入住信息进行查询得到的信息。

上图中,如果双击某条记录,则可对该记录的部分字段进行修改。

对旅客的房间号和床位号可重新编辑,更改旅客的入住信息。

2、除了能够按等级进行入住信息的查询外,还能进行各等级房间剩余床位的查询。

下图是“普通三人间”的剩余床位信息。

3、按入住日期和姓名查询曾经入住旅客的信息(历史信息)

下面的窗体是输入查询日期为“2004-3-8”时的情况。

也可以进行入住日期和姓名的组合查询,这里不在赘述。

 

四、单击“系统”菜单下的“系统重置”菜单项,可实现对系统数据库中旅客信息的清空,以便该系统的重复利用。

五、退出系统

界面如下所示:

单击“确定”退出系统。

六、程序代码

暂略。

 

展开阅读全文
相关资源
猜你喜欢
相关搜索

当前位置:首页 > 经管营销 > 企业管理

copyright@ 2008-2022 冰豆网网站版权所有

经营许可证编号:鄂ICP备2022015515号-1